I see this song as told from the perspective of a fundamentalist preacher--most likely a fundamentalist Christian who preaches to born-agains.

-In goodness wake I'll always say I do, -That it's all for you

Everything good I've done, it is for God (or Jesus, or Allah).

-And tricks I'd turn would always shine right through, -But it's all for you.

Though I lie through my teeth ("tricks I turn"), and that's how most people see me, God knows I am devout and I'm doing it for the right reason.

--Like a stream overflowing --Unpredictable --A new confidence like a new king.

I have the ultimate confidence in my charms, in the strength of my faith. It gives me power, "like a new king," and that only swells my confidence. The faith of my subjects overflows and what they may do is unpredictable.

-Like a breeze levitating -To raise a sunken soul -And to the surface shines like a new pin.

We are all raised spiritual through belief in Christ. Even the worst man ("Sunken soul") can be raised to heaven, and can shine with Goodness.

-Like a dream synchronising -With the one I missed the most -A concentrated love from a new queen.

In heaven we can meet with those we miss the most.

-Like a wave stabilising -I walk a tighter rope -And my new victim shines like a new pin.

The rope of virtues is tougher to walk as fame grows, but every sinner I touch I make shine with Virtue.

-I can feel lies within the -Gospels that I'm sold -The tactless sentiments are a new pain.

But I know that I am overzealous, that I am greedy, and that I am a bad man at heart. The Gospels say I'm a devil.
